The effect of temperature on solubility depends on the type of reaction that occurs during the process of dissolving the solute in the solvent. Increasing the temperature always decreases the solubility of gases. Heat is required to break the bonds holding the molecules in the solid together. This is why sugar dissolves better in hot water than in cold water. When a solid dissolves in a liquid, a change in the physical state of the solid analogous to melting takes place. The substances that are solids at room temperature and pressure tend to become more soluble when the temperature rises.
